Position Overview

We are seeking an Engineer Project Manager to join our dynamic Aviation team in Reno, NV. The ideal candidate will lead and manage aviation and airfield projects, from design to execution, ensuring projects are completed within scope, schedule, and budget.

What You Will Do

  • Project Leadership & Management: Develop construction plans, contract documents, and technical reports; define project scopes; manage budgets; coordinate resources; oversee project schedules; prepare monthly invoicing and PSRs; support or lead new sales initiatives.

  • Stakeholder Coordination & Communication: Serve as the main point of contact for sponsors, the FAA, and other key stakeholders; coordinate meetings; prepare agendas and schedules; document outcomes; ensure alignment and progress throughout the project lifecycle.

  • Documentation & Compliance: Review client-provided documents; coordinate subconsultants; ensure compliance with federal, state, and local grant application processes, as well as environmental regulations.

  • Bidding & Construction Support: Manage the bidding process; organize pre-bid meetings; prepare addenda; review bid proposals; oversee change orders; conduct site visits during construction; ensure quality standards are met.

  • Project Close-Out: Review and approve final engineering drawings; summarize project costs; conduct final inspections with the FAA and sponsors; ensure successful project completion.

  • Client & Team Management: Lead cross-functional teams; build and maintain client relationships; collaborate with management on client satisfaction, risk management, and financial performance; provide mentorship and guidance to team members.

What You Will Bring

  • Bachelor's degree in Civil Engineering

  • Professional Engineer (PE) license required

  • 10+ years of proven experience in project management for aviation and airfield design projects

  • Familiarity with FAA Advisory Circulars and federal aviation regulations

  • Proficiency in AutoDesk Civil 3D, AutoCAD, and other relevant engineering software

  • Strong working knowledge of Microsoft Office suite

  • Excellent verbal and written communication skills

  • Strong analytical skills with the ability to read, interpret, and apply scientific, technical, and financial documents

  • Ability to effectively respond to sensitive client inquiries and manage relationships with regulatory agencies and stakeholders

  • Ability to sit for extended periods

  • Occasional travel for site visits and client meetings
